What is Hybrid Work?
Hybrid work is a work system that allows employees to work from different locations, either from the office or from home according to a predetermined schedule.
In this model, employees do not have to be present every day at the office like in a conventional work system.
Companies usually set a certain combination, for example three days in the office and two days working from home.

How Does Hybrid Improve Work Life Balance?
One of the biggest advantages of hybrid work is that it helps create a balance between personal and work life.
Employees have more time with their families because they don't have to travel to the office every day.
Time that is usually spent on the road can be diverted to more productive activities.
Can Hybrids Reduce Stress?
In most cases, yes.
A long journey to the office often causes physical and mental fatigue.
With work days from home, stress levels due to traffic jams and travel can be reduced significantly.

Do Hybrid Systems Benefit Companies?
Yes.
Many companies can reduce operational costs such as electricity, office space and other facilities.
Apart from that, companies also have access to talent from various locations without having to limit the recruitment process to certain areas.
How Does Hybrid Help Productivity?
Several studies show that many workers feel more focused when working from home because of the lack of certain distractions that often occur in the office.
However, productivity still depends on the individual's ability to manage time and complete tasks.
Are All Jobs Suitable for a Hybrid System?
No.
Some jobs require direct physical presence so it is difficult to implement in a hybrid system.
But many digital professions can make excellent use of this working model.

Why is Communication a Challenge in Hybrid?
When some team members work from the office and others work from home, communication can become more complex.
Information that is not conveyed properly has the potential to cause misunderstandings and work delays.
How to Overcome Communication Problems?
Companies need to use effective digital collaboration platforms and ensure every team member gets the same information.

Can Hybrid Make Employees Less Connected?
Yes.
Social interactions in the office often help build stronger relationships between team members.
As the frequency of meetings decreases, some employees may feel more isolated.
Why is Self-Discipline So Important in Hybrid?
Hybrid systems provide greater freedom.
However, this freedom must be balanced with the ability to manage time and responsibilities independently.
Employees who have difficulty managing their time will usually face greater challenges when working from home.
